Cloud and Edge Infrastructure
The Philippines is rapidly expanding its cloud and edge infrastructure to support the growing demand for scalable and reliable computing resources. Major cloud providers like Microsoft Azure and Google Cloud have established significant footprints in the region.
Edge computing is particularly relevant in the Philippines, where network latency can be a challenge. By deploying edge servers closer to end-users, companies can reduce latency and improve the performance of real-time applications. The adoption of edge computing is driving innovations in sectors like telecommunications and e-commerce.
Observability and SRE in the Philippines
Observability and Site Reliability Engineering (SRE) are critical for maintaining the stability and performance of software systems. In the Philippines, companies are increasingly adopting observability tools like Prometheus and Grafana to monitor their applications and infrastructure.
SRE practices, as outlined in Google's SRE handbook, are being integrated into the development lifecycle to ensure high availability and reliability. Continuous monitoring, automated recovery, and proactive incident management are key components of effective SRE in the Philippines.

Identity and Access Management
Identity and Access Management (IAM) is crucial for securing applications and data in the Philippines. Implementing robust IAM solutions, such as OAuth 2.0 and OpenID Connect, ensures that only authorized users can access sensitive information.
Multi-factor authentication (MFA) and role-based access control (RBAC) are essential components of a comprehensive IAM strategy. By enforcing strong authentication and access policies, companies can mitigate the risk of unauthorized access and data breaches.
